Stats
Stats are core attributes that directly affect a character’s performance. They appear on gear, consumables, enchantments, and gems.
Each stat has diminishing returns once the bonus reaches +20% from equipped sources, so balancing them is key to maximizing effectiveness.

Embellishments
Embellishments are special effects tied to crafted items. Some are built into recipes, while others can be added using optional reagents.
Only two embellished items can be equipped at a time, so choosing the right effects is crucial. The following embellishments are most commonly used in top Shadow Priest builds for 2v2.

Gems
Gems provide bonus secondary stats and help fine-tune a character’s build. They are crafted through Jewelcrafting and socketed into gear.
Additional sockets can be added to Neck and Rings using the Magnificent Jeweler's Setting , or to other gear using a seasonal item typically sold by the Token of Merit vendor near the Great Vault.

How is this Shadow Priest 2v2 guide created?
The guide is created by collecting live data from the 50 top-rated Shadow Priests in 2v2, using the Battle.net API . Their builds are then analyzed to identify the most used stats, talents, gear, and enhancements for Season 3.
How often is the information updated?
The data is refreshed every 8 hours.
